But here’s my personal, non-negotiable rule: immediately locate the bonus terms and conditions. This document is your blueprint. You need to scrutinize the wagering requirements, which could range from 30x to 50x the bonus amount. That means if you get 100, you might need to wager 3,000 to 5,000 credits before any winnings become withdrawable. Look for game weightings too; slots often cont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ack or roulette might only contribute 10% or even be excluded. A maximum bet limit while the bonus is active is also common, often capped at $5 or $10 per spin. Ignoring these rules is the fastest way to see your bonus and any associated winnings voided.
